Output 886a672dddfd2ac14bc85e4d76e55e9ab6b6efce4ed88646345dc42d1ce4ff89:0

value
3620292
script pubkey
OP_0 OP_PUSHBYTES_20 572cca6a77762ffa63be27e607ef002d6c46fdeb
address
bc1q2ukv56nhwchl5ca7ylnq0mcq94kydl0t7xz8lr
transaction
886a672dddfd2ac14bc85e4d76e55e9ab6b6efce4ed88646345dc42d1ce4ff89
confirmations
144659
spent
true